企业采购管理系统的设计与实现

时间:2022-06-03 09:18:39

企业采购管理系统的设计与实现

摘要:本文介绍了一个物资企业采购管理系统的开发实例。重点从系统结构、业务流程、数据库设计及主要功能模块设计着手,介绍了该系统的设计思路和实现过程。系统选择了SQL Server 2000作为开发平台,并以VB6.0作为开发工具。

关键词:采购;库存;VB

中图分类号:TP315文献标识码:A文章编号:1009-3044(2007)15-30598-02

Design and Implementation of an Enterprise Purchase Management Information System

XUE Xiao-feng

(Jiangsu Teachers University of Technology,Changzhou 213001, China)

Abstract:This paper introduces an enterprise procurement of materials management system. Focusing on the system architecture, business process, database design and main modules of the system, introduces the system design and implementation process. This system chooses SQL server 2000 as the development platform and VB 6.0 as the development tool.

Key words:purchase; inventory; VB

1 引言

采购是企业向供应商购买商品的一种商业行为,企业经营活动所需要的物资大部分是通过采购获得的。随着市场竞争越来越激励,采购管理在“供、产、销”这一物流管理中的重要作用也逐步突出出来。如何降低采购成本、提高企业资金利用率、降低采购风险,是每个企业必须面对的问题。只有使用先进的计算机管理系统,才能有效进行企业的采购管理,提高企业的核心竞争力

2 采购系统的总体设计

2.1 系统设计目标

通过使用采购管理系统,可以方便地为企业内部管理采购货物信息。为此,本采购系统主要分为采购管理、到货管理、库存管理和退货管理4部分。

2.2 系统功能

2.2.1 系统设置

系统设置中可以增加操作员、修改操作员的密码和删除操作员。在增加完操作员信息之后,可以给该操作员分配操作权限。可以备份和恢复数据,保证系统的安全。

2.2.2 采购管理

对采购员信息、供应商信息和采购材料信息进行管理;录入采购订单和查询采购订单信息,完成从供应商处购进货物并且签订订单的过程。在查询采购订单的时候可以根据各种基本信息查询或根据日期查询。

(1)到货管理

管理签订采购订单后的到货信息。对同一张订单可以分批次地到货,并且可以随时查询到任何一张订单的任何一笔到货信息记录。

(2)库存管理

货物到货以后,就应该对货物进行盘点入库。入库是对到货而言的,每一张到货单对应一张入库单。

(3)退货管理

维护退货信息和查询退货信息。可以分批退货和一次性退货。

2.3 系统结构图

采购管理系统功能结构如图1所示。

2.4 业务流程

在采购管理系统中,主要按着采购到货入库退货的流程对采购的货物进行管理,其业务流程如图2所示。

2.5 采购系统的数据库设计

图1 系统结构图

图2 系统业务流程图

在采购管理系统当中,共设计了8张数据表。其中采购定单表Table_cgdd和库存信息表Table_kcb是系统中最重要的数据表。这两张表的逻辑结构如下:

采购订单表Table_cgdd

库存信息表Table_kcb

3 系统主要功能模块设计

3.1 采购定单管理模块

企业依据采购合同进行商业采购活动。在采购定单管理中,单击[添加]按钮,单号自动生成,然后在“货物名称”文本框中按下键选择订货信息,选择完毕后按下键。订单管理窗体中除了数量、批号、金额和备注信息之外,其他信息全部自动录入到相应文本框中,最后输入数量,系统自动核算金额。

图3 采购订单管理窗体

3.2 到货信息维护模块

到货管理是对采购订单中所涉及货物的接收管理。到货管理模块主要实现对订单到货信息的管理。对于同一个订单,可以进行多次到货并且每一次到货后,订单数量都能够相应的减少。

图4 到货信息维护窗体

3.3 库存信息维护模块

库存管理是针对到货信息进行的管理。单击[增加]按钮之后,只需在“单号”旁边的文本框中直接按下键,即可弹出需要入库的到货信息窗口,在窗口中选择所要入库的到货信息,然后单击[保存]按钮将所录入的信息保存到数据库当中。

图5 库存信息维护窗体

4 结束语

该采购管理系统数据高度共享,减少了数据冗余度,能缩短企业资金周转周期,人机界面友好,安全可靠,适用于中小物资企业,有利于推动企业信息化建设,具有较好的推广价值。

参考文献:

[1] 东乐工作室. Visual Basic 6.0 应用与提高[Z]. 1999.

[2] 明日科技. Visual Basic 数据库系统开发完全手册. 人民邮电出版社,2006.

[3] 张勇. 网络进销存管理系统的设计及其安全策略[J]. 现代计算机,2004.

注:本文中所涉及到的图表、注解、公式等内容请以PDF格式阅读原文。

上一篇:超炫顶级装备,成就强者梦想 下一篇:浅谈SQL查询功能的三个理论基础